The anticipation is building as K-pop sensation ITZY prepares for their comeback, with just 10 days remaining until the release of their new mini-album, 'Motto.' The title track, sharing the same name, encapsulates a core message of self-assurance and mutual trust between the group and their dedicated fanbase, MIDZY. This concept, 'Motto,' is being presented as a solid foundation built on the sincerity and confidence of the five members: Yeji, Lia, Ryujin, Chaeryeong, and Yuna.
Over the past five days, ITZY has been steadily unveiling individual video content across their official social media channels. These releases have offered fans glimpses into the album's aesthetic and the members' individual charms, further fueling excitement for the upcoming release. The strategy of releasing individual content before the full album drop is a common yet effective way in the K-pop industry to build momentum and allow fans to connect with each member's unique contribution to the overall concept.
